Economist Nouriel Roubini has shared his insights on inflation in the US and future economic trends, highlighting potential risks.
Inflation Expectations
Nouriel Roubini stated he expects core inflation in the US to rise to 3.5% by the end of 2025. He added that the second half of 2025 will likely experience weaker growth and possibly a recession, while interest rate cuts from the Federal Reserve won’t happen before December.
Economic Forecasts and Risks
Roubini characterized the expected economic slowdown as a 'mini stagflationary shock' and warned that inflation remains too high for the Fed to pivot. He believes that the personal consumption expenditures index remains stubbornly above target, confining the Fed's options.
Atlas America Fund Strategy
Roubini, currently a portfolio manager at the Atlas America Fund (USAF), discussed the fund's strategy aimed at shielding investors from threats like inflation and economic shocks. Since its launch, the fund has achieved over 5% growth, despite its assets remaining relatively small at around $17 million.
